What color is 858F9F?

The RGB color code for color number #858F9F is RGB(133, 143, 159). In the RGB color model, #858F9F has a red value of 133, a green value of 143, and a blue value of 159.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 16.4% cyan, 10.1%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 37.6%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 216.9° (degrees), 11.9 % saturation, and 57.3 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#858F9F has a hue of 216.9° (degrees), 16.4 % saturation and 62.4 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of 858F9F?

Color code 858F9F has an LRV of nearly 27. By LRV value, it is a medium color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
